Patent number: 9762620Abstract: A method, system, and a computer program product for reducing consumption of resources for lawful interception or retention data related to traffic concerning a 2G/3G target mobile connected to a telecommunications network interworking with Evolved Packet System is provided. A first parameter value in traffic for which lawful interception or data retention has been activated is detected at a first node. Based on at least the first parameter value, whether the traffic will be intercepted or retained at a second node crossed by the traffic is evaluated. If the second node will intercept or retain the traffic, the first node foregoes a lawful interception request or retention of intercepted data.Type: GrantFiled: April 21, 2015Date of Patent: September 12, 2017Assignee: Telefonaktiebolaget LM Ericsson (publ)Inventors: Maurizio Iovieno, Raffaele de Santis

Patent number: 9461916Abstract: Methods and arrangements are provided for maintaining a wanted Quality of Service transmission level of Lawful Interception (LI) payload data to a Law Enforcement Agency (LEA) via an HI3 interface in a LI system. The data is acquired from an intercepted IP packet flow and belongs to one or more target identities using a specific Internet communications service. The method, which is performed by the arrangement, includes monitoring the state of congestion of IP packets in the HI3 interface in relation to a first threshold level T1 and a second threshold level T2. The first threshold level T1 corresponds to a lower level of congestion than the second threshold level T2. The transmission of LI payload data is controlled based on the monitoring and a priority classification assigned to the LI payload data to be transmitted.Type: GrantFiled: March 26, 2012Date of Patent: October 4, 2016Assignee: Telefonaktiebolaget LM Ericsson (publ)Inventors: Paolo D'Amora, Raffaele De Santis, Lorenzo Fiorillo

Patent number: 8903988Abstract: The present invention relates to methods and arrangements for optimizing monitoring capacity in a telecommunication system comprising at least one information element receiving unit. One activity report request along with identities of a target to be monitored are received at the element receiving unit. At least two information elements belonging to a first element group, related to the specified target by different identities and comprise duplicate information are also received at the target. The element receiving unit selects one of the received at least two elements.Type: GrantFiled: April 4, 2008Date of Patent: December 2, 2014Assignee: Telefonaktiebolaget L M Ericsson (publ)Inventors: Rita Di Donato, Raffaele De Santis, Roberto Cicco, Luca Di Serio

Publication number: 20140328348Abstract: The present disclosure provides embodiments of a method, an arrangement and an entity adapted to provide a Law Enforcement Agency with payload data of an intercepted Internet Protocol flow. The payload data belongs to one or more target identities using a specific Internet service. An Mediation functionality MF3 comprises a receiver configured to receive from an Intercepting Control Element intercepted payload data belonging to one or more target identities using a specific Internet service. The mediation functionality MF3 further comprises classifying means for classifying the payload data by identifying the specific IP service to which the received payload data belongs, and marking means configured to mark each IP packet of the received payload data with a service identifier corresponding to classification of the specific IP service to which the received payload data belongs. The marked payload data offers real-time usage and analysis of the content of interest.Type: ApplicationFiled: December 16, 2011Publication date: November 6, 2014Applicant: TELEFONAKTIEBOLAGET L M ERICSSON (PUBL)Inventors: Raffaele de Santis, Lorenzo Fiorillo

Patent number: 8606190Abstract: Lawful Interception (LI) management system for retrieving user and/or traffic data associated to a given target identity of a telecommunication network. The system comprises an Administration Function device and at least one Mediation/Delivery Function device. The LI management system comprises a first common handover interface to both a Data Retention Sources domain and an Intercepting Control Elements domain and a second common handover interface to at least one Law Enforcement Agency. The first common handover interface is configured to receive user and/or traffic data from both Data Retention Sources and Intercepting Control Elements.Type: GrantFiled: October 28, 2008Date of Patent: December 10, 2013Assignee: Telefonaktiebolaget LM Ericsson (publ)Inventors: Francesco Attanasio, Raffaele De Santis

Patent number: 8223927Abstract: The present application relates to monitoring non-local originating calls in a telecommunication system having a local network part and a non-local network part. A monitoring centre is attached to an Intercept Access Point in the local network part. A monitoring request comprising an external target identification is received from the monitoring centre to the Intercept Access point. A call is set-up of from an originating subscriber in the non-local network part, towards the local network part. An Initial Address Message comprising the originating subscriber's identity is received to the Intercept Access point from the non-local network part. A match is found between the Initial Address Message and the received target identification. Monitoring information related to the matched target is transferred from the Intercept Access Point to the monitoring centre.Type: GrantFiled: February 14, 2008Date of Patent: July 17, 2012Assignee: Telefonaktiebolaget LM Ericsson (Publ)Inventors: Luca Di Serio, Raffaele De Santis, Roberto Cicco, Rita Di Donato, Biagio Maione

Patent number: 8107480Abstract: Methods and apparatuses to enhance delivery capacity for traffic in a communication network are disclosed. Traffic is received to a Delivery Function with originally coded Quality of Services (QoS). A specification of requested QoS is received to the Delivery Function. The originally coded QoS is established to be higher than the requested QoS. The received traffic is transcoded into requested QoS. Optionally, the traffic is buffered with originally coded QoS and at request, the buffered traffic is retrieved.Type: GrantFiled: December 28, 2006Date of Patent: January 31, 2012Inventors: Amedeo Imbimbo, Raffaele De Santis

Publication number: 20110055910Abstract: The present invention relates to methods and arrangement for user-centric interception in a telecommunication system wherein correlated identities are federated in an Identity Management Controller. The method comprises: Sending from an Intercept Unit to the Identity Management Controller, a request for identities correlated with a specified key target identity. The Intercept Unit receives identities federated to the specified key target identity. The received identities are utilized for user-centric interception purposes.Type: ApplicationFiled: June 6, 2007Publication date: March 3, 2011Inventors: Francesco Attanasio, Raffaele De Santis
